Description:
This was Remington's first revolver and they were only made for a total of two years, 1857 and 1858.  It is an extremely small, (only 7 inches from the muzzle to the back of the grips) and it has a unique outside-mounted hand that rotates the cylinder.  This is the first one that we have ever seen that is cased with the bullet mold, powder flask, and cap tin.  The case is contemporary to the pistol, but has likely been re-lined at some point in the last 50 years or so.  The revolver is in very good original condition with areas of original bright blue finish still present on the barrel, with the balance of the metal showing as a blue/brown patina.  The original gutta-percha grips are in excellent condition, free from cracks or repairs and showing very little wear.  The bore is average, there is some light pitting scattered throughout and the rifling is worn but still visible.  The mechanics of this Remington Beals 1st Model work perfectly.  The hammer still has the safety position and the full cock position, the cylinder still rotates "in time" when the action is worked, and the trigger breaks cleanly and resets properly.  The Remington company was, and still is, one of the major American firearm manufacturing firms, and this cased revolver is very significant in that it was their very first mass produced revolver sold to the general public.  This would be an excellent addition to any antique American arms collection, and it would be very hard to upgrade from this example.
